Description

Nacro, a leading provider of holistic support services spanning education, housing, justice, and health and wellbeing, is embarking on an ambitious initiative to elevate its operational efficiency and bolster service quality. We invite dynamic and innovative vendors to participate in this transformative journey by offering comprehensive solutions tailored to our unique requirements.

Project Objective:
The primary aim of this endeavour is to revolutionise Nacro's housing and support management systems to better align with our strategic imperatives of enhancing financial sustainability, fostering growth, cultivating a vibrant work environment, and elevating user experience. Through the deployment of cutting-edge Housing Management System (HMS) and Support Management tools, we aim to streamline operations, optimise resource utilisation, and elevate service delivery standards.

Contract Structure:
Interested parties are invited to bid for two lots:

Lot 1: Housing Management System
Lot 2: Support Management tool

The contract duration spans five years, with a provision for extension by an additional five years. Payment terms will be negotiated, with implementation costs structured as upfront payments aligned with deliverables and ongoing licensing fees settled annually.

Success Criteria:
The success of this project hinges on several key factors, including:

* Seamless integration of systems with Nacro's business processes, eliminating the need for workarounds and ensuring robust data management.
* Empowering colleagues with user-friendly interfaces accessible across diverse devices and locations, while offering customers convenient online engagement options for self-service and access to our array of services.
* Ensuring adherence to legal and ethical obligations, thereby safeguarding the welfare and security of our service users.

IMPORTANT:
All prospective suppliers must hold accreditation in either Cyber Essentials Plus or ISO27001.
